当前位置: 首页 > 产品大全 > IIoT设备数据采集 核心技术与软件开发功能介绍

IIoT设备数据采集 核心技术与软件开发功能介绍

IIoT设备数据采集 核心技术与软件开发功能介绍

工业物联网(IIoT)作为工业4.0的核心组成部分,其设备数据采集功能的实现依赖于多项关键技术和系统的软件开发。本文将深入探讨IIoT设备数据采集中的重要技术环节及其在软件开发中的功能实现。

一、设备数据采集的核心技术

  1. 传感与通信技术
  • 传感器技术:高精度、耐环境的传感器是实现数据采集的基础,能够实时监测设备的温度、振动、压力等参数。
  • 通信协议:支持Modbus、OPC UA、MQTT等工业标准协议,确保设备与系统间的稳定数据传输。
  • 边缘计算:在数据源头进行初步处理和过滤,减少网络负载并提升响应速度。
  1. 数据处理与分析技术
  • 数据清洗与标准化:消除噪声数据,统一数据格式,为后续分析奠定基础。
  • 实时流处理:利用Apache Kafka、Flink等工具实现高速数据流的实时处理。
  • 机器学习和AI算法:通过异常检测、预测性维护等模型,从海量数据中提取有价值的信息。
  1. 安全与可靠性技术
  • 数据加密:采用TLS/SSL等加密技术,保障数据传输过程中的安全性。
  • 设备身份认证:防止未授权设备接入系统,确保数据来源的可信度。
  • 冗余与容错机制:通过多路备份和自动故障转移,提高系统的可用性。

二、IIoT软件开发的典型功能介绍

  1. 设备管理功能
  • 设备注册与配置:支持设备的快速接入和参数配置。
  • 状态监控:实时显示设备运行状态、在线/离线情况。
  • 远程控制:允许用户通过软件对设备进行启停、参数调整等操作。
  1. 数据采集与存储功能
  • 多源数据采集:能够从不同类型的设备和传感器中采集数据。
  • 时序数据库支持:使用InfluxDB、TimescaleDB等数据库高效存储时间序列数据。
  • 数据缓存与同步:确保在网络不稳定时数据不丢失,并支持离线同步。
  1. 数据分析与可视化功能
  • 仪表盘展示:通过图表、曲线等形式直观呈现设备数据和关键指标。
  • 报警与通知:设定阈值,自动触发报警并通过邮件、短信等方式通知用户。
  • 报告生成:定期生成数据报告,支持导出为PDF、Excel等格式。
  1. 系统集成与扩展功能
  • API接口:提供RESTful API,便于与ERP、MES等企业系统集成。
  • 模块化设计:支持功能模块的灵活添加和定制,适应不同行业需求。
  • 云平台兼容:能够部署在公有云、私有云或混合云环境中。

三、IIoT软件开发实践要点

  1. 采用敏捷开发方法,快速迭代以满足不断变化的需求。
  2. 注重用户体验,设计直观的操作界面和交互流程。
  3. 实施持续集成和部署(CI/CD),提高开发效率和软件质量。
  4. 进行多维度测试,包括功能、性能、安全性和兼容性测试。

结语
IIoT设备数据采集技术的成熟与软件功能的完善,正推动工业智能化迈向新高度。随着5G、人工智能等技术的融合,IIoT系统将变得更加智能、高效和可靠,为工业企业创造更大价值。

更新时间:2025-12-02 09:12:33

如若转载,请注明出处:http://www.hwfyxsxt.com/product/7.html